Question
jake compact disc of diamter 4.8 inchs what is the circumference of the disc round your answer to the nearest hundredth

To find the circumference of a circle (or disc), you can use the formula:
\[
C = \pi \times d
\]
where \(C\) is the circumference and \(d\) is the diameter. In this case, the diameter of the disc is 4.8 inches.
Using \(\pi \approx 3.14\):
\[
C \approx 3.14 \times 4.8
\]
Calculating this gives:
\[
C \approx 15.072
\]
Rounding to the nearest hundredth:
\[
C \approx 15.07 \text{ inches}
\]
So, the circumference of the disc is approximately **15.07 inches**.
